Awards and Recognition: A Comprehensive Overview

Joe Rogan’s career spans decades. You know, it’s been quite a journey. With that, he’s gathered many different awards. He’s won in podcasting, stand-up comedy, and even MMA commentary. His ability to do so many things well is a trademark. It’s what makes his career special. This versatility is amazing.

Let’s start with a big one. He won Best Comedy Podcast. This award came from the iHeartRadio Podcast Awards. Rogan’s podcast, The Joe Rogan Experience, began in 2009. It quickly became super popular. It’s always been one of the top podcasts. He won that comedy podcast award in 2020. That really shows his podcasting power. It truly solidified his place.

A report from Statista says something incredible. As of 2023, his podcast has over 11 million listeners. That’s per episode, mind you! It makes it the most popular podcast worldwide. This isn’t just a trophy. It shows how Rogan truly shaped podcasting. He helped make waves, honestly. He paved the way for others. This award highlights his pioneering spirit.

Beyond podcasting, Rogan has earned praise for MMA. He won “Color Commentator of the Year.” This award came from the World MMA Awards. He’s won it multiple times. This recognition means so much. It acknowledges his talent for analyzing fights. He provides insights that improve the viewing experience. Fans really listen to him. They trust his words.

The 2021 World MMA Awards saw him win again. This cemented his place as a top commentator. This event is very prestigious in MMA. Thousands of votes come in every year. The awards celebrate the sport’s best. Rogan’s wins show his deep knowledge. They also show his real passion for mixed martial arts. Its quite the sight. He brings a unique energy.

Rogan also got noticed in television. His show was called *Joe Rogan Questions Everything*. It received a nomination. That was for Best Reality Show. The Critics Choice Television Awards gave it that nod. He didn’t win, but the nomination was big. It proved his TV venture was well-received. It showed his podcast persona could shine on TV. Case Study 1: The Elon Musk Episode

In 2018, Joe Rogan hosted Elon Musk. This was on The Joe Rogan Experience. This episode became one of the most talked-about. During their chat, Musk smoked a joint. This led to massive media buzz. It caused a huge public discussion. This episode broke viewership records. It also showed Rogan’s ability to attract big guests. He could foster conversations that mix fun with deep thought.

It led to talks about new ideas and technology. It even touched on humanity’s future. The episode went completely viral. It showed how Rogan’s platform impacts public talk. This solidified his role as an influencer. He’s much more than just entertainment. It genuinely shaped how we talk about tech leaders.

Counterarguments and Criticisms

Of course, Joe Rogan has faced critics. Some say his platform spreads misinformation. This is especially true regarding health topics. Critics point to episodes where guests shared unverified claims. This raises questions about a podcaster’s responsibility. It’s about how they handle content. However, Rogan has often defended his approach. He stresses the importance of open dialogue. He believes in diverse perspectives.

This debate shows a big point. It’s about media figures shaping public talk. Rogan’s awards show his influence. But they also bring scrutiny. People question the content he shares. Balancing open discussion with careful reporting is key. This remains a big issue in media today. Frankly, it’s a tough line to walk. It’s a true dilemma.
